Main Duties and Responsibilities:
- Support the People & Talent team across all stages of the recruitment process.
- Deliver timely and professional communication to candidates regarding interviews, feedback, and next steps.
- Maintain and update the Applicant Tracking System (ATS) with accurate and complete candidate information.
- Ensure job vacancies are posted across relevant job boards and the company careers page.
- Complete initial candidate screenings from job boards and share shortlisted profiles with hiring managers.
- Collect and securely file all required candidate documentation, including right-to-work records, monitoring information, references, qualifications, and certifications.
- Liaise with hiring managers to coordinate interview logistics, including availability, meeting rooms, interview packs, and virtual Teams calls when required.
- Assist with internal and external events, representing the company to attract potential talent.
- Support sourcing efforts by identifying potential candidates through various channels.
- Prepare and issue offers of employment and contracts to successful candidates.
- Contribute to recruitment campaigns and related activities.
- Generate and present monthly recruitment KPIs using the ATS and Power BI.
- Maintain, update, and manage a variety of People & Talent tracking spreadsheets to ensure data accuracy.
- Update and organise key Talent documentation, such as job descriptions, employment contracts, and onboarding materials.
- Communicate new starter information to relevant departments to ensure a smooth onboarding process.
- Coordinate IT, HSE, and other equipment requirements for new starters with the appropriate teams.
- Oversee the end-to-end process of employee referral vouchers, including verification, issuance, and accurate record-keeping.
